FOF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

39 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cohen & Steers Closed End Opportunity Fund (FOF)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$42.3M — down 2.9% from $43.6M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new FOF posit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 11 added to existing stakes and 13 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Shaker Financial Services,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.24M. The largest seller was Financial & Investment Management Group, cutting an estimated $1.33M.
